Carmel cost of living is 113.9
COST OF LIVING | Carmel | Indiana |
---|---|---|
Grocery | 101.2 | 92.9 |
Health | 85.7 | 82.2 |
Housing | 151.7 | 61.7 |
Median Home Cost | $437,800 | $186,100 |

Is Carmel Indiana safe?
According to a report by safewise.com, both Fishers and Carmel made the top 10 list of the most safest cities for families in the whole United States. Carmel, Indiana came in as the 3rd most safest city in America, and right behind it at number 5 safest is Fishers, Indiana.
Does it snow in Carmel Indiana?
Carmel, Indiana gets 42 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38 inches of rain per year. Carmel averages 23 inches of snow per year. The US average is 28 inches of snow per year.

What’s the poorest city in Indiana?
Indiana: Knox
Knox is a small northern Indiana town of 3,500. The poorest town in the state, Knox has a median annual household income of $33,709, about $18,500 less than the median income across the state as a whole. Real estate values are often indicative of what area residents can afford.
What is Carmel in known for?
Carmel Becomes the Roundabout Capital of the World
If fact Carmel has become known around the world as the “Capital of Roundabouts”. According to the city of Carmel, since the late 1990’s Carmel has been building and replacing signalized intersections with roundabouts.
